Solar Panel Installers in Navsari
Browse solar panel installers in Navsari by city. We have listings in 6 cities.
Bansda
Find solar installers in Bansda
View installersChikhli
Find solar installers in Chikhli
View installersGandevi
Find solar installers in Gandevi
View installersJalalpore
Find solar installers in Jalalpore
View installersKhergam
Find solar installers in Khergam
View installersNavsari
Find solar installers in Navsari
View installers